Pompey at Euro 2008 update #1

Well the first round of group games involving current Pompey players performing at Euro 2008 have been played with 2 out of 3 playing, the 3rd was an unused sub - but all 3 nations that they represent are yet to taste defeat.

Milan Baros, although technically now a Lyon player once again - having returned to the French side without a deal yet being agreed, was unable to take to the field as his Czech Republic side kicked off the tournament against co-hosts Switzerland with a 1-0 win on Saturday.

Sunday saw Niko Kranjcar start for Croatia, playing an hour of their 1-0 win over the other host nation Austria.

Finally today, in what was probably one of the worst games in European Championship history Lassana Diarra was unable to get onto the field as the French played out a 0-0 draw with Romania - he was probably struggling to stay awake in all honesty...

If I were Harry Redknapp, if we could afford it, I would be trying to find out the agents details for a fair few of the players on display in the Holland against Italy game, as there were some outstanding displays in the game of the tournament so far - was it sneakay who had said this would be the case?
